Position Summary

As our Director, Learning & Organizational Development, you will be an integral part of a collaborative team and lead cultural development initiatives that distinguish us as an employer of choice. What you'll be doing

  • Lead the design, development, implementation and evaluation of programs, policies and strategies tailored to meet OD needs and program goals
  • Regularly assess workplace experience across the organization and oversee follow-up at all levels
  • Bring forward Homewood Health strategic issues, recommendations and solutions
  • Support the identification and implementation of the best and most current HR and organizational development practices
  • Manage an L&OD Manager who supports leaders and teams through learning and coaching opportunities and an Inclusive Culture Consultant who leads the implementation of our DEI Strategic plan
  • Provide expert facilitation, coaching and consultation to leaders regarding effective leadership and team development
  • Manage the individual talent development planning process for executives and emerging leaders
  • Build a succession planning framework and work with leaders to prepare individual succession plans for critical roles
  • Drive the continuing implementation of the National Standard for Psychological Health and Safety in the Workplace
  • Create and deliver change management and employee engagement programs, while undertaking OD interventions and recommending solutions to address gaps
  • Act as a resource to the HR team to develop team-building exercises and workshops, diagnose potential organizational problem areas and resolve conflict within groups
  • Establish and track L & OD performance indicators, measuring quality, consistency and effectiveness and make recommendations to support continuous improvement
  • Collaborate on the development and refinement of the HR strategic plan to drive the organization's strategic priorities
  • Provide insights and advice on the selection of off-the-shelf training content

What we're looking for

  • 5 - 7 years' combined experience coaching and supporting teams and leaders in an OD capacity, developing and facilitating corporate learning programs in a complex, multi-site organization and developing / implementing OD initiatives and projects, including a minimum of two years in a management capacity.
  •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Industrial Psychology or other relevant discipline; Master's degree in organizational development / organizational behavior is an asset
  • CPHR and OD certification preferred; certification related to coaching is an asset (ICF or other)
  • Demonstrated knowledge of adult learning styles, participative training design, group dynamics, interactive learning, leadership coaching and conflict resolution
  • Superior verbal and written communication skills; French skills are an asset
  • Demonstrated ability to think and act with strategic and tactical agility, prioritize and drive tangible results
  • Proven ability to design, develop and deliver effective and engaging learning sessions, programs and presentations, both in person and remotely
  • Adept with a variety of multimedia training platforms and methods
  • Effective in a fast-paced, changing, service-centric environment
  • Ability to perform and interpret needs analyses and translate findings into development / training strategies
  • Ability to work independently and also build relationships as part of a team environment where interpersonal and partnering skills are valued
  • Knowledge of competency modeling, selection and training, organizational development and performance management
  • Proficiency with Word, Excel and PowerPoint; effective at creating learning assessments, resources and presentations
